Overnight Lane Closures on Eastbound and Westbound State Route 4 in The City Of Martinez for Drainage Work

Contra Costa County — Caltrans will perform overnight drainage work on SR-4 between Interstate 80 and McEwen Road, resulting in lane closures in both directions. This work involves drainage improvements to maintain roadway integrity and improve stormwater flow along the SR-4 corridor.

Closure Details: All work is weather dependent and subject to change

Location: Eastbound SR-4 Between WB I-80 to McEwen Road

  • Closure Type: Alternating lane closures (Lane #1 and #2 of 3)
  • Date: Friday, July 10, 2026
  • Time: 7:00 p.m. to 10:00 a.m. (following morning)

Location: Westbound SR-4 Between McEwen Road and I-80 corridor limits

  • Closure Type: Lane #2 closure (2 of 2 lanes affected intermittently)
  • Date: Friday, July 10, 2026
  • Time: 9:00 p.m. to 10:00 a.m. (following morning)

Traffic Impacts: Motorists are advised to expect delays and prepare to merge and allow extra travel time. Changeable message signs (CMS) will be posted throughout the corridor to assist drivers. For 24/7 traffic updates, follow 511.org on X. For real-time traffic, visit Caltrans QuickMap.
